3.分别用if和switch编程,输入0-100分成绩,输出相应的成绩档次。

设: 90分以上为’A’; 80-89 分为’B’; 70~79 分为’C’; 60-69 分为’D’;60分以下为E’。

if语句

#include <stdio.h>
void main(){int grade;printf("请输入成绩:\n");scanf("%d",&grade);printf("grade=%d",grade);if(grade>=90){printf("成绩为:A");}else if(grade>=80){printf("成绩为:B");}else if(grade>=70){printf("成绩为:C");}else if(grade>=60){printf("成绩为:D");}else{printf("成绩为:E");}}
}

switch语句

#include <stdio.h>
void main(){int grade;printf("请输入成绩:\n");scanf("%d",&grade);printf("grade=%d",grade);switch(grade/10%10){case 9:printf("成绩为:A");break;case 8:printf("成绩为:B");break;case 7:printf("成绩为:C");break;case 6:printf("成绩为:D");break;default :printf("成绩为:E");break;}
}

不懂请留言,谢谢!

C语言学习之分别用if和switch编程,输入0-100分成绩,输出相应的成绩档次。相关推荐

  1. C语言学习之求1-1/2+1/3-1/4+···+1/99-1/100

    C语言学习之求1-1/2+1/3-1/4+···+1/99-1/100 #include <stdio.h> int main(){int a=1;//定义+,-的变量double x,y ...

  2. C语言学习笔记-----scanf【通过键盘将数据输入到变量中】(两种用法)

    C语言学习笔记-----scanf[通过键盘将数据输入到变量中](两种用法) 用法一:scanf("输入控制符",输入参数): 功能: 将从键盘输入的字符转化为输入控制符所规定格式 ...

  3. 奥鹏20年12月作业考核(C语言专科),《C语言(专科)》20年12月作业考核【答案100分】...

    该楼层疑似违规已被系统折叠 隐藏此楼查看此楼 <C语言(专科)>20年12月作业考核 共20道题 总分:100分 100分 咨询dddda98 咨询dddda98 咨询dddda98 单选 ...

  4. Go 语言学习总结(7)—— 大厂 Go 编程规范总结

    一.接口使用 1.如果希望接口方法修改基础数据,则必须使用指针传递 type F interface {f() }type S1 struct{}func (s S1) f() {}type S2 s ...

  5. perl语言学习第一篇:将文本perl.txt内容读入,再格式化输出(菜鸟小试牛刀)

    实习较闲,自学perl,刚看完菜鸟教程,小试牛刀 下面的程序主要是读入perl.txt文件 cat perl.txt 4 karsa 1 uzi 3 xiaohu 2 ming 5 langx 然后格 ...

  6. oracle数据库作业1,北京语言20秋《Oracle数据库开发》作业1(100分)

    -[北京语言大学]20秋<Oracle数据库开发>作业1 试卷总分:100    得分:100 第1题,Orcacle提供了(),用于支持采用向导方式创建数据库. A.SQL*Plus B ...

  7. C语言——实现用链表存储学生信息,当输入0退出输入,并查找学号为3的学生是否存在

    功能实现: 1.往链表内录入学生的学号信息: 2.当输入的学号为0时候,退出录入: 3.查找链表内是否有学号为3的学生. 编译执行结果: 代码实现: #include <stdlib.h> ...

  8. 5.29 C语言练习(计算数字个数:从键盘输入一串字符,输出字符串里的数字字符数。)

    [练习] 题目要求:从键盘输入一串字符,输出字符串里的数字字符数. #include "stdio.h" int main() {char a[100];int i,num=0;g ...

  9. 【c语言】 有一函数: 写程序,输入x的值,输出y相应的值。用scanf函数输入x的值,求y值

    #include <stdio.h> int main() {int x,y;scanf_s("%d", &x);if (x < 1) //if 和els ...

最新文章

  1. tesseract-ocr3.02字符识别过程操作步骤
  2. 机器学习中的数学意义
  3. 解决table边框在打印中不显示的问题
  4. 【百度地图API】小学生找哥哥——小学生没钱打车,所以此为公交查询功能
  5. Redis 高级教程 Redis 分区(6)
  6. Ubuntu21.04 deepin-wine 微信输入中文乱码,黑块,和多余窗口问题解决
  7. 什么是DNS,A记录,子域名,CNAME别名,MX记录,TXT记录,SRV 记录,TTL值
  8. 笔记本电脑cpu排行_2020年笔记本电脑推荐总篇(详细参数amp;选购推荐)
  9. C#并行编程(1):理解并行
  10. mysql全套基础知识_Mysql基础知识整理
  11. Spring2.5注解事务配置
  12. python--模拟掷骰子游戏
  13. java——MP3转wav
  14. 机器学习中的多分类任务详解
  15. 中国石油行业并购重组趋势与投资战略规划建议报告2022~2028年
  16. ORAN C平面 Section Extension 8
  17. Python 生成、识别社会统一信用代码
  18. Android Bitmap关于setPixel设置的值和getPixel获得的值不一样的问题
  19. 运维岗位面试被问到的问题
  20. 支付宝当面付参数获取步骤,个人申请使用支付宝当面付

热门文章

  1. react 组件遍历】_从 Context 源码实现谈 React 性能优化
  2. Serverless 工程实践 | 细数 Serverless 的配套服务
  3. 云原生编程挑战赛--Serverless创新应用赛邀您提交方案啦!
  4. 还在为多集群管理烦恼吗?RedHat 和蚂蚁、阿里云给开源社区带来了OCM
  5. 程序员该知道的7个必经阶段
  6. 揭秘!文字识别在高德地图数据生产中的演进
  7. 游戏中的卡片模态面板设计【1】—运用案例分析
  8. 《怪物猎人》战斗核心设计分析
  9. Java_小球自由落体_小球下落问题
  10. 零基础学Python-爬虫-5、下载音频